Job Summary As a Principal Architect, you will serve as a trusted executive advisor responsible for influencing our clients’ cybersecurity transformation strategies. This role enhances field sales productivity by delivering business-relevant consulting to strategic customers. You will lead cross-functional teams to orchestrate advisory-style engagements, ensuring sales campaigns align with customer executive priorities and drive them to successful security outcomes.

Requirements

  • 8+ years of experience in a senior role as an end customer, cybersecurity vendor, or consultant.
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science (BSCS) or equivalent practical experience.
  • Deep technical knowledge of and hands-on experience with security operations, SIEM, endpoint security, and incident response.
  • Demonstrable experience establishing credibility and delivering strategic messaging to large enterprise executives (CISO and above).
  • Ability to travel a minimum of 50% of the time to customer and company locations.

Responsibilities

  • Establish and maintain executive-level relationships (CISO and above) in strategic accounts to drive growth.
  • Advocate for Palo Alto Networks’ transformative solution architectures, reshaping client security strategies through strategic conversations.
  • Proactively collaborate and exchange information with sales, engineering, and Unit42 teams to develop differentiated proposals that demonstrate clear business and technical value.
  • Conduct high-impact consulting engagements, including architectural assessments and workshops, to set a strategic agenda with the customer.
  • Identify and document client strategic goals and priority outcomes, working with specialists to build business cases around measurable benefits.
  • Provide expert insights to clients on risk reduction, operational excellence, and cost management.
  • Serve as a key resource to Product Management, providing insights on current challenges, competitive intelligence, and emerging market needs.
  • Challenge curiously by maintaining continuous learning to sustain technical leadership across security technologies, cyber threat intelligence, and emerging tech like AI.
